Apple Valley, MN, experiences an average of 38 inches of snowfall each year, with temperatures often dropping below 0°F in the winter months. When pipes freeze, they expand and can burst, causing significant water damage to your property. It’s essential to be proactive and take steps to prevent this from happening to you.   • Prevent frozen pipes by insulating exposed pipes in unheated areas like the garage, basement, or crawlspace.
  • Keep your home warm, especially if you’re going to be away for an extended period.
  • Consider installing freeze-proof faucets or frost-proof spigots outside.

Common Questions About Frozen Pipe Water Damage Restoration

What causes frozen pipes?

Frozen pipes are caused by a combination of cold temperatures and lack of insulation. When water inside the pipe freezes, it expands and can cause the pipe to burst.

Can I prevent frozen pipes?

Yes, you can prevent frozen pipes by taking steps to insulate exposed pipes, keeping your home warm, and considering installing freeze-proof faucets or frost-proof spigots outside.
